India proposes retaliatory duties following EU's extension of safeguard measures on certain steel products
After India and the European Union (EU) failed to reach consensus on the EU's restrictive safeguard measures on certain steel products, New Delhi has proposed imposing retaliatory duties under World Trade Organisation (WTO) norms on certain goods imported from the EU.
